Greening Your Home for Less

“When it comes to living at home, it’s so easy,” said Lisa Beres in a recent conversation with GreenConnected.com.

After a news segment on “Greening Your Home” for less than $250 dollars, Lisa and Ron Beres addressed thousands of home owners for whom health continues to be a strong catalyst for change.

“It’s incredibly accessible,” said Lisa, “Greening the home has been a stronger catalyst than energy efficiency or resource conservancy for the individual.  Putting in a solar system is going to cost you thousands of dollars, but filtering your air or changing your mattress will only cost a few hundred.”

For many, the most important issue inside the home remains air quality.  With the rise of asthma and respiratory problems quadrupling in the past few years, Ron Beres noted that “cleaning products, pesticides applied, or the VOCs in paint and other building materials all affect air quality.”

GreenNest.com’s Website and Products

The top-sellers on GreenNest in terms of volume are shower filters and air purifiersBaby products are popular with young mothers.  Lisa and Ron just consulted with Trista Sutter from ABC’S  The Bachelor and helped to green her child’s nursery. 

“We used low VOC paints, a Baby’s Breath air purifier, and organic bedding,” said Lisa Beres.  “In fact, Trista also uses our organic blankets for her child when she travels to hotels with crib sheets that are not organic.”

In Greg Horn’s book Living Green, he notes that a major source of out-gassing resides in bedding and mattresses, which are treated with flame retardant chemicals.  The problem is:  Organic mattresses must often be ordered from outside the U.S.

Lisa explained that all her mattresses meet U.S. federal standards “because they use organic wool, which acts as a natural flame retardant.”  Greennest.com’s completely organic bedding materials are either 100% organic cotton, 100% natural latex, or virgin wool.
